Resumen de Mont Miller

Mont Miller Ski Resort, located in the heart of Murdochville, is renowned for its sensational skiing and snowboarding experiences. The resort boasts an impressive range of tracks for all experience levels, with a notable number of challenging black runs for more skilled participants. The courses are adorned with all-natural powdered snow, offering 300m of winter fun to its visitors. The view from the top is breathtaking, adding to the overall experience.

The resort is open on weekends, providing ample time for the snow conditions to build up to their optimal state. The quality of snow in Murdochville is consistently good, and the resort's location at the foot of the town adds to its charm. The resort's atmosphere is lauded by visitors, who appreciate the friendly, helpful staff and the incredible ambiance of the rustic chalet. The trails are lightly trafficked, lending an old-fashioned charm to the skiing experience.

However, the resort has its challenges. The T-bar lift system, while offering an authentic skiing experience, can be uncomfortable and prone to breakdowns. Additionally, the best slopes at the very top of the mountain are only accessible off-piste. There have also been occasional issues with equipment rental and a lack of clear signage to guide visitors. Despite these drawbacks, the resort maintains its appeal through its unique charm and dedicated staff.

Mont Miller is not just a ski resort; it is a hub for outdoor enthusiasts. The Chic-Chac next door offers an excellent après-ski experience, and the resort itself can be the perfect place to warm up before tackling Mont Porphyre. With its diverse trails, quality snow, and fantastic atmosphere, Mont Miller Ski Resort is a must-visit for those seeking an authentic skiing experience.
